
新型JavaScript代码格式化工具发布

标题“js格式化工具~~~~”和描述“一款格式化JavaScript代码文件的小软件”所指向的知识点,主要集中在JavaScript代码格式化工具的应用、功能、优势以及如何使用这一类工具来改善和优化JavaScript代码的阅读性和可维护性。
JavaScript代码格式化工具是一种软件或服务,用于自动调整JavaScript代码的布局,使之符合一定的编码风格和规范,常见的操作包括缩进、括号的使用、变量命名规范、空格和换行等格式调整。它可以帮助开发者减少代码审查时对风格一致性的关注,将精力更多地集中在代码逻辑和功能性上。
### JavaScript格式化工具的主要功能:
1. **自动缩进**:根据设定的规则自动调整代码的缩进层级,让代码的层次结构清晰可见。
2. **括号匹配**:确保代码中的括号成对出现并正确闭合,通常还会调整括号的格式,使其更加美观。
3. **空格和换行**:在适当的位置插入空格或换行符,以提高代码的可读性,如运算符前后添加空格,代码块前后添加空行等。
4. **统一命名规范**:帮助统一变量、函数、类等的命名方式,减少代码风格上的差异。
5. **注释格式化**:对代码中的注释进行格式化,包括位置、风格、对齐等,使得注释更加规范和易于理解。
### 使用JavaScript格式化工具的优势:
1. **提高代码质量**:统一的代码风格使得代码更容易阅读和理解,减少维护难度。
2. **减少错误**:格式化过程中可能会发现一些编程错误,比如缺少括号、错误的空格使用等。
3. **方便团队协作**:团队成员遵循相同的编码规范,可以减少代码审查时的摩擦,提升团队协作效率。
4. **节省时间**:自动化格式化代码可以节省开发者手动调整格式的时间,让开发者可以专注于更重要的编码工作。
### 如何使用JavaScript格式化工具:
1. **选择合适的格式化工具**:根据个人喜好或团队要求选择合适的格式化工具,可以是在线工具、文本编辑器插件或独立的软件应用。
2. **安装配置**:下载并安装所选的格式化工具,并根据需要配置相关的参数,如缩进大小、使用单引号还是双引号、换行符类型等。
3. **格式化代码**:将要格式化的JavaScript代码导入工具,可以是复制粘贴,也可以是通过文件导入。然后执行格式化操作。
4. **代码审查和优化**:格式化后需要对代码进行审查,确保格式化没有引入新的逻辑错误或不符合项目实际需求的情况。
### 示例文件分析:
- **jsci.exe**:这应该是一个JavaScript格式化工具的可执行文件,通过运行这个程序,用户可以对JavaScript代码进行格式化处理。
- **jsci.ini**:是一个配置文件,用于设置jsci.exe工具的配置参数,如默认的编码风格、格式化选项等。
- **English.lng / Chinese.lng**:是语言包文件,提供了用户界面的语言支持。在本例中,提供了英语和中文两种语言,使得不同语言背景的用户能够更容易地使用这款工具。
综上所述,JavaScript格式化工具对于前端开发或任何涉及JavaScript代码编写的项目来说都是一项非常有用的技术工具。它不仅能够提升代码的整洁性和一致性,而且还能促进开发团队的协作效率。掌握如何使用这些工具,是每个前端开发者不可或缺的技能之一。
相关推荐








dwert
- 粉丝: 3
最新资源
- 深入解析Struts1.1源码结构与应用
- PDF转文本工具源码解析与应用
- 深入解析BHO开发:文档对象事件响应技巧
- Flex初学者必备资源:快速入门与帮助手册
- 基于JSP和SQL2005的新闻发布系统开发介绍
- JavaScript基础教程手册下载指南
- VB编程实现100至300随机数生成与自动排序
- 软件工程文档模板应用指南
- 基于JavaScript的全功能日历选择器实现
- 中文版Web开发全面手册集锦
- SSH Web工程中监听器实例的应用与优势
- 第三版雷达手册:全面解析最新雷达系统
- VB实现的摄像头监控程序功能介绍
- 图形化Hash函数:数据结构实现与VC平台应用
- 分享带有复选框的JavaScript树形控件实现
- 三层架构C# ASP.NET实现公司新闻发布系统
- 利用Flash创造生动DNA动画效果
- 传感器技术与信号处理在现代应用中的实践
- VC++.NET实现的手写数字识别系统详解
- Flash与ASP整合实现新闻数据读取教程及源代码
- Hibernate API中文版 - 英文能力不足开发者的福音
- 利用特殊字符实现网页瘦身的方法
- Linux软件安装速成教程
- VC6.0开发必备:opengl库文件glut下载与配置